About this map

The Little Blue River winds through the southern portion of this landscape, anchoring a rural territory where the Missouri Pacific railroad once played a central role in local transport. The small settlement of Pauline serves as the primary community hub, positioned near the river's bend and several industrial Sandpit sites. The surrounding countryside is divided into named townships like Hanover and Glenville, where the presence of Hanover Ch, Cem, and School No 75 indicates the established social fabric of these Nebraska farming communities.

Map Details

Date Portrayed1969
Date Published1972
PublisherU.S. Geological Survey
Map TypeTopographic
Scale1:24,000
Physical Dimensions22 x 26.9 inches
